Transaction bbeb623f52560a363b8cdca8a28db3712440a35fa1e2ae90fc3c56c8c1ca4b84
1 Input
2 Outputs
- bbeb623f52560a363b8cdca8a28db3712440a35fa1e2ae90fc3c56c8c1ca4b84:0
- bbeb623f52560a363b8cdca8a28db3712440a35fa1e2ae90fc3c56c8c1ca4b84:1
value 14100
address 16uDCZCMSMhsBNbL32Vt8me1mhsAj69v2B
value 29565383
address 37W1AL1sfN6SGn4i1JLaFfkohLPx34FsTp